- MOHANA KRISNANJun 10, 2023 · 2 years agoAccording to industry experts, the duration of a bear market in cryptocurrencies can vary widely. It can take anywhere from six months to two years for a bear market to be considered over. During this period, prices generally decline, and investor sentiment remains negative. However, it's important to note that the end of a bear market is not solely determined by time. Factors such as increased adoption, positive regulatory developments, and improved market sentiment can contribute to the recovery of the crypto market. So, while it's essential to be patient, it's equally important to stay informed about the latest industry trends and news.
